Description
John Bunyan’s The Pilgrim’s Progress was first published in 1678. It has never been out of print and has been translated into more than 200 languages. The original title of the book was The Pilgrim’s Progress from The World to That Which Is to Come and it was written while Bunyan was in the Bedfordshire County Jail. His crime was conducting religious services outside the auspices of the established Church of England. J. John’s contemporary retelling is for a new generation of readers. Whether you are already a pilgrim or are considering the Christian journey, this story will inspire and instruct you through life’s adventures and obstacles. It’s not just the story of a man called Christian, it is also a mirror that reflects something in everyone’s soul journey.
